Certified Organic Porcelain Hardneck Garlic
Organic German Extra Hardy seed garlic is a Central European-style Porcelain maintained in North America for dependable cold-winter growth. It is often discussed alongside German White and German Hardy, and some seed lines may share ancestry, but this stock is sold under the Extra Hardy name. Certified organic bulbs offer large cloves, strong flavor, edible scapes, and broad Zone 3–8 guidance.

The cloves have strong, spicy, classic garlic flavor. Raw preparations such as pesto, salsa, aioli, and dressings show its heat most clearly; roasting or simmering develops a sweeter and rounder profile for soups, braises, potatoes, and sauces. Large cloves are well suited to whole-clove roasting and reduce preparation time when a recipe calls for generous quantities of garlic.
When growing German Extra Hardy, choose a sunny bed where winter cold can do its work and water drains away after snowmelt. Set the cloves in fall with time to establish roots, then follow local practice for winter mulch. In spring, keep the row weed-free and evenly watered, and harvest the scapes while tender. Start checking bulbs when the lower leaves brown around mid-summer, then cure the harvest in a dry, shaded, airy place.
Variety Details
- Type: Porcelain hardneck garlic
- Flavor: Strong, spicy, and classic
- Bulbs & Cloves: Typically 4–7 cloves per bulb; bulb size and count vary with growing conditions
- Appearance: Substantial bulbs beneath clean white wrappers
- Planting Time: Fall
- Approximate Harvest: Mid-summer; timing varies by climate and planting date
- Zones & Climate: Zones 3–8; selected for reliable cold-winter growth
- Storage: Cure completely and store cool, dry, and ventilated
